Bill_S Posted September 19, 2014 Author Share Posted September 19, 2014 Progressing slowly but surely... The blue is a piece of an old Revell Corsair wheel, with plastic sheet glued to widen it. It enabled me to put the cavity in the wheel well also. Lots of sanding still to do; I'm in dire need of an abrasive cotton swab... Next up are the heat vents. The hoses are .015" solder tightly wrapped around .015" floral wire. Probably no more updates until after the server migration.
